#7b25f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b25f5 is composed of 48.2% red, 14.5%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.8% cyan, 84.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 264.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 55.3%. #7b25f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f64aff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

● #7b25f5 color description : Bright violet.
#7b25f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b25f5 has RGB values of R:123, G:37,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 8070645.
